Denali Skies

by Danielle Rohr

Age rating: Ages 14–17 · Young Adults

Age rating and Christian content guidance for parents.

A young woman named Sarah travels to Alaska and discovers a hidden world of ancient beings and a prophecy.

Things to consider

Sexual Content20

Sarah and Liam share a few kisses and romantic moments.

Violence / Gore30

There are some fights and threats against Sarah and her friends.

Profanity / Language0

No profanity is present in the text.

Blasphemy0

No blasphemy is present in the text.

Substance Use0

No substance use is depicted.

Suicide & Self-Harm0

No suicide or self-harm is depicted.

Scary / Disturbing20

Some scenes involve shadowy figures and mild peril.

Occult & Witchcraft60

The story features ancient beings, prophecies, and magical elements.

Sexuality & Gender Themes0

No LGBTQ+ themes are present.

Worldview & Spirituality0

The worldview is not explicitly non-Christian.

Anti-God or Christian Portrayal0

No negative portrayals of God or Christians are present.

Virtues to celebrate

Courage & Sacrifice40

Sarah shows courage facing unknown dangers in Alaska.

Faith & Hope10

Faith is not a central theme, but there are mentions of destiny.

Love & Friendship30

Sarah develops a romantic connection with Liam.

Forgiveness & Redemption10

Themes of overcoming challenges are present.
